U+1CF3D "𜼽" Znamenny Combining Mark Dvoetochie is a diacritical mark used in the Znamenny chant notation, a musical system employed in the Russian Orthodox Church. This specific combining mark, named "Dvoetochie," is placed above a neume to indicate a specific rhythmic or melodic nuance, helping to guide the singer in the performance of the chant. As part of the broader Znamenny notation repertoire, it contributes to the precise transmission of sacred music traditions, reflecting the rich cultural and liturgical heritage of Eastern Slavic Christianity.

General Properties

Code Point U+1CF3D
Version Added 14.0
Name Znamenny Combining Mark Dvoetochie
Block Znamenny Musical Notation
General Category Nonspacing Mark
Canonical Combining Class Not Reordered
Bidirectional Class Nonspacing Mark

Encodings

HTML Decimal Encoding 𜼽
HTML Hex Encoding 𜼽
UTF-8 Encoding 0xF0 0x9C 0xBC 0xBD
UTF-16 Encoding 0xD833 0xDF3D
UTF-32 Encoding 0x0001CF3D
C/C++/Java Escape \ud833\udf3d
